Why do we help each other out? Even when it gets us nothing in return? Becky Ripley and Emily Knight explore the existence of altruism, with the help of some mischievous magpies.
Featuring Professor Dominique Potvin from the University of the Sunshine Coast, and Dr Abigail Marsh from Georgetown University.
Produced and presented by Emily Knight and Becky Ripley.
